About The Position

Trustbridge Hospice, a part of Empath Health is seeking a System Integration Analyst/Developer to support the design, development, and optimization of integrations between our cloud and on-premise business systems. This full-time position works Monday through Friday, 8:30 a.m. - 5:00 p.m., and plays a vital role in ensuring seamless data flow and communication across our organization. Since 1978, Trustbridge Hospice has cared for more than 200,000 South Florida families. As a community-based nonprofit, we provide 24/7 hospice and palliative care, along with caregiver support and bereavement services for families facing serious illness.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in a field of study such as Computer Science, Information Technology, Clinical Informatics or equivalent combination of professional training and experience.
  • Broad knowledge of application integration and data flow in complex business environments.
  • 3-5 years of proven experience in system integration, data repositories, and clinical or patient record systems.
  • Ability to develop and document technical specifications for new and existing interfaces.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ills with the ability to work independently.

Nice To Haves

  • Familiarity with healthcare or hospice operations preferred.

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, test, implement, and optimize integrations between key business systems across Empath Health.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to analyze workflows and configure system business rules to meet organizational needs.
  • Research and resolve complex integration and data flow issues requiring creativity and initiative.
  • Develop technical documentation, including data mappings, process diagrams, and interface specifications.
  • Educate and support team members with less technical knowledge to promote understanding and effective use of integrated systems.
